Power Analysis Through Simulations in STATA: A Step-by-Step Guide
Författare
Summary, in English
You want to run an experiment where you anticipate finding a treatment effect.
How large should your sample size be to have a reasonable chance of detecting
significant results? In this manuscript, I present and explain the Stata code I use to
address this question. The code uses simulations to conduct power analyses,
offering a flexible alternative to the commonly used analytical tools. Unlike
traditional methods, this approach can accommodate any experimental design and
statistical test that Stata supports. The code is straightforward, user-friendly, and
can be used effectively with minimal coding experience.
